Who were the girondists, and how did they respond to robespierre's reign of terror?

(c) they were more moderate revolutionaries who arrested Robespierre and executed him

What is the relationship between the Declaration of Independence and the Constitution? *

The Declaration of Independence, which officially broke all political ties between the American colonies and Great Britain, set forth the ideas and principles behind a just and fair government, and the Constitution outlined how this government would function.Explanation:
